The Bucks played in the Pinebridge Center that was in the middle of town. There was also a hotel, an indoor pool, and workout facilities at the time.
The old building and hotel was acquired by Mayland Community College on 2015. It currently houses the YMCA of Mitchell County and the cosmetology program for Mayland Community College, along with other spaces for various uses.
